Each summer, the Memorial Art Gallery presents a showcase of regional art. This year, it’s the turn of the Rochester Biennial, an invitational featuring five individuals—Roberto Bertoia of Ithaca (sculpture), Yvonne Buchanan of Syracuse (video), Val Cushing of Alfred (ceramics), Eunsuh Choi of Rochester (glass) and David Higgins of Corning (painting)—and the team of Larson & Shindelman (Marni Shindelman of Rochester and Nate Larson of Baltimore) (photography). As in previous years, one artist (Buchanan) was selected on the strength of her work in last year’s Rochester-Finger Lakes Exhibition.


This exhibition is underwritten by the Elaine P. and Richard U. Wilson Foundation, with additional support from the Rubens Family Foundation and Jane W. Labrum.
